Dr Alex Grech
Alex Grech has 30 years’ experience in business strategy and change management. After completing his accountancy articles, he held senior management positions in the European HQs of IPSA Reuters and Hitachi Data Systems. Alex was an advisor within the Office of the Prime Minister of Malta under different administrations; and Director Strategic Business Development of Go during the successful IPO on the LSE. He is the founding Chairman of Heritage Malta and founding editor of “Technology Sunday”, the technology supplement for the Times of Malta. Alex is currently the national expert on EU working groups on ICT in education and the future of higher education, and a senior advisor to the Ministry of Education on digital pedagogies and online learning.
Alex has a PhD in Internet Computing from the University of Hull, and his research interests are in digital citizenship, social media and power. He is a Visiting Senior Lecturer in Digital Strategy at the University of Malta and an Honorary Research Fellow at the University of Hull.
Alex is also an alumni of Rheingold U, the online learning community of internet visionary Howard Rheingold.

Liz Ayling
Liz Ayling is a communications specialist of over 25 years with a strong analytical and research background. She is an experienced journalist, editor, trainer and copywriter. In our network, Liz’s prime role is managing web content projects, handing architecture and content delivery for both large, complex sites as well as SMEs and solopreneurs. She has particular experience in delivering WordPress solutions.
Before StrategyWorks, Liz worked for the European Commission in London; in marketing with one of the ‘big eight’ accounting firms; and as a client account handler with an international advertising agency. Liz holds a BA (Hons) European Studies (Bath); a post-graduate Diploma in Journalism (City, London); and a Masters with distinction in Digital Media (Sussex). She speaks German and Italian and has conversational French.
